Volutaria lippii), C. muricata (Volutaria muricata), C. repens (Rhaponticum repens) and S. babylonica (Centaurea babylonica), is discussed. Designations of nomenclatural types based on the consultation of Linnaeus's original material and the literature cited in the respective protologues are proposed. Three names are lectotypified using specimens from both Linnaeus herbarium at LINN and the illustrations from Isnard and Dodoens. Furthermore, a neotype is designated for Serratula babylonica from a specimen at LINN.en10.1111/njb.01234info:eu-repo/semantics/closedAccessTypifications of Linnaean names in the genus Centaurea and Serratula (Asteraceae)Article351121123Q3WOS:000395002800018Q3
